RelationshipTerri O’Neale is the mother of six ranging in age from three to twenty-two. She has at various times been a stay-at-home mom, working mother and for five years a single one. Her motto is…I don’t raise children; I raise functioning, contributing members of society. After a decade long career in fundraising, she is now proud to say that she is a full-time mother and author and a part-time doula/childbirth educator.<br>Terri’s writings include on-line articles on pregnancy, birth, breastfeeding and parenting; including “VBAC Vs Elective Caesarean - What is Right For Me?” She has in less than a year become one of Ezine’s most prolific and re-published authors in the Parenting, Pregnancy and Motherhood categories. Her story of recovering from birth trauma was published in June 2008 by the popular UK magazine Pregnancy, Baby and You. Her latest endeavour is the Frugal Family blog series that offers ideas and insights into how families can spend more time together, save money, be more environmentally friendly and live healthier. In addition to these non-fiction works, she also writes romantic and erotic fiction.<br>For information and inspiration, Terri draws upon not only her twenty plus years as a mother, but also her BS in health education and her environmental management studies at the post-graduate level. She also holds certifications as birth and post-partum doula and is working on a further in childbirth education. Terri has also trained as a breastfeeding peer counsellor with two major organisations. Terri currently lives in London, England with her best friend, soul-mate and second husband Paul.<br><br>
